What companies run services between Rajiv chowk, Delhi, India and Netaji Subhash Place Station, India?

You can take a subway from Rajiv Chowk to Netaji Subash Place via Kashmere Gate in around 34 min. Alternatively, Delhi Transport Corporation (DTC) operates a bus from Shivaji Stadium Terminal to Wazirpur DTC Depot / Netaji Subhash Palace every 5 minutes. Tickets cost ₹11–70 and the journey takes 50 min.
